ZONING
The intent of the SR - Suburban Residential Zoning District is to provide a variety of residential
lifestyles with densities generally ranging up to seven units per net residential acre. Residential
development of seven dwelling units per acre are permitted when both public/community water
and sewer services are available. The proposed single family subdivision is a permitted Class
(1) use in the SR zoning district.

ENVIRONMENTAL REVIEW -
A Determination of Nonsignificance was issued for this subdivision on March 23, 2005. The
mitigation measure required that all stormwater be maintained on site. This determination was
issued following a 20 -day comment period. No significant comments were received and no
appeal was filed. No additional SEPA review is required for the Final Plat.

`MC § 14.20.210 sets forth the following process for final plat approval:
A. Upon receipt of a proposed final plat, the City Council shall, at its next public meeting, set a
date for consideration of the final plat. Notice of the date, time, and location of the public
meeting shall be given to, the subdivision applicant, Surveyor, City Engineer, Office of
Environmental Planning, and the Yakima County Health Officer at least four days prior to the
date of the public meeting.
B. The City Council shall review the final plat during the public meeting and shall approve the
final plat if the Council determines that the final plat conforms to the conditions of preliminary
plat approval and applicable state laws and meets the requirements of this title as they
existed when the preliminary plat was approved.
C. Upon approving any final plat, the City Council shall authorize the Mayor to sign the final plat
as evidence of City Council approval. (Ord. 98-65 § 2 (part), 1998).
